Commit Graph

  • 1b7f9d3ebc Et2SelectEmail: Give dragged tags some z-index, so they go over the other controls nathan 2023-02-06 15:07:30 -0700
  • cd980c78df Limit mail to & cc addresses to 1 row, show all on hover. Use: multiple="true" rows="1" maxTagsVisible="1" to trigger show all on hover nathan 2023-02-06 14:48:55 -0700
  • c48e2dccf1 fix explode(): Argument #2 ($string) must be of type string, array given ralf 2023-02-06 20:38:14 +0100
  • e4acb0eac1 fix an other substr(): Passing null to parameter #1 ($string) of type string is deprecated ralf 2023-02-06 20:27:59 +0100
  • 6e1de33a23 fix server- and client-side had different attribute-names for legacy-options ralf 2023-02-06 17:14:22 +0100
  • 330ffe73df fix somehow wrong legacy-options for customfields widget ralf 2023-02-06 16:31:14 +0100
  • 5ade68dd76 Add collabora action into default and set attachments label Hadi Nategh 2023-02-06 16:15:21 +0100
  • bd8198d230 missing et2-select-lang widget ralf 2023-02-06 15:52:58 +0100
  • ab6338f13f * TimeSheet: allow to update times in events tab rows by clicking on the time @todo nathan: setting min/max values on Et2DateTime loaded via a template into dialog does NOT work, as widget has not instantiated Flatpicker, when the dialog.getUpdateComplete promise returns and the widget then simply ignores the set min/max time :( ralf 2023-02-06 14:42:02 +0100
  • 28d8a73ace Fix broken vfs size indicator Hadi Nategh 2023-02-06 12:10:15 +0100
  • dda3b1f5d1 Remove excessive BR tag from email tag Hadi Nategh 2023-02-06 11:33:50 +0100
  • e9c960671a Fix alignment and color for mail subject in preview Hadi Nategh 2023-02-06 11:23:19 +0100
  • 88edfc8d3f
    Update mail_label4.svg StefanU 2023-02-03 22:12:38 +0100
  • 1d8d4f9c72 Fix some readonly issues where widgets were not looking readonly - Editable tags were still editable if the select was readonly - LinkTo could still select an app (readonly not passed on) - Hide the dropdown for multi-select when readonly nathan 2023-02-03 14:08:27 -0700
  • 3a695bd45d
    Add some svg icons StefanU 2023-02-03 21:47:14 +0100
  • 846defb42e fix missing curl caused nodejs install to fail ralf 2023-02-03 20:29:01 +0100
  • 1faeffebee Stop Widget::get_array() creating unwanted indexes nathan 2023-02-03 11:31:39 -0700
  • 888c3f30a2
    Update phone.svg StefanU 2023-02-03 18:02:22 +0100
  • 1880606fb6
    Update cti_phone.svg StefanU 2023-02-03 18:00:24 +0100
  • 6c327e7a64 * LDAP/Addressbook: make further LDAP attributes available as custom-fields using "ldap_<attribute>" as name for accounts in LDAP ralf 2023-02-03 11:28:43 +0100
  • c2714a6813 * Univention: make birthday of users available in addressbook (univentionPerson.univentionBirthday attribute) ralf 2023-02-03 11:26:17 +0100
  • 4b342db97e fix some warnings / notices in session creation ralf 2023-02-03 09:57:37 +0100
  • 4f0e65c1a5 fix not working login with domain selectbox ralf 2023-02-03 09:56:51 +0100
  • 21599f6097 Make all toolbar toggle button icons gray when off nathan 2023-02-02 10:46:51 -0700
  • 929bf866cd Et2Lavatar: Fix missed property camelCase contact_id -> contactId nathan 2023-02-02 09:19:04 -0700
  • 138999f233 Add again full value as tooltip for email tags Hadi Nategh 2023-02-02 12:12:08 +0100
  • 746220defc * LDAP: fix LDAP protocol error creating new groups without a description make sure not to unset (empty) description for new groups ralf 2023-02-02 08:56:53 +0100
  • b4eafbcd70 * LDAP: fix LDAP protocol error creating new groups without a description make sure not to unset (empty) description for new groups ralf 2023-02-02 08:56:53 +0100
  • 3d1c405a19 Bump symfony/http-kernel from 5.4.6 to 5.4.20 dependabot[bot] 2023-02-02 01:27:36 +0000
  • 4ddf327185 Bump symfony/http-kernel from 5.4.6 to 5.4.20 dependabot[bot] 2023-02-02 01:27:36 +0000
  • 1fa9d91d59 Et2Description: Fix links were not clickable nathan 2023-02-01 14:31:17 -0700
  • 346a720d27 Et2LAvatar: Update statustext (tooltip) with name based on lname & fname nathan 2023-02-01 14:06:54 -0700
  • 86376bdc0c Et2DateRange: Add relative -> absolute conversion as needed when setting value nathan 2023-02-01 13:04:25 -0700
  • 15f986cf1a Get Et2Date & Et2DateTime tests passing again nathan 2023-02-01 09:46:00 -0700
  • 933d13c8b2 Mail: Only add attachment action to open in Collabora for files that should be opened in Collabora nathan 2023-02-01 08:57:31 -0700
  • e397e43c1b Fix PGP back/restore dialog Hadi Nategh 2023-02-01 14:15:56 +0100
  • dba604ca59 removed now unnecessary and not used lavatar parameter, as it caused multiple requests to same picture because auf different urls ralf 2023-02-01 08:43:07 +0100
  • cce1088486 Mail: Add attachment action to open in Collabora nathan 2023-01-31 15:03:18 -0700
  • 49c9939e67
    Update selectcols.svg StefanU 2023-01-31 20:33:55 +0100
  • ab56ad1171 Et2Select: Handle paste of CSV into selects with allowFreeEntries nathan 2023-01-31 09:47:46 -0700
  • 5cb375fabf Get font-size of server-side lavatar similar to client-side Hadi Nategh 2023-01-31 16:24:51 +0100
  • 0b15ede568 Et2Date: Fire change event when a new date is selected Fixes nm date filters not filtering nathan 2023-01-30 16:10:49 -0700
  • 328c8224cb Set 'selectUnit="true"' for all date-durations in nm rows for consistant display nathan 2023-01-30 15:43:32 -0700
  • e575c40ff3 Some missed cases where client-side lavatar was not used nathan 2023-01-30 15:26:09 -0700
  • f120607e4b fixing the fix ;) ralf 2023-01-30 17:36:21 +0100
  • a8c8c94144 fix class EGroupware\Api\Api\Link not found ralf 2023-01-30 17:08:47 +0100
  • 1a37abd472 fix timer is shown even without timesheet permissions ralf 2023-01-30 16:59:48 +0100
  • 9ad73f1ea1 fix LDAP/AD clients to query jpegphoto so its existence get used by the regular code to (not) generate avatar-url ralf 2023-01-30 16:50:05 +0100
  • cc885c343f Add textsize preference into required to reload list Hadi Nategh 2023-01-30 16:07:21 +0100
  • 403a836ee4 Adjust the icons size base on textsize preference Hadi Nategh 2023-01-30 15:59:28 +0100
  • 0eff86f61a fix SQL-backends of accounts and contacts to return either avatar-url or initials ralf 2023-01-30 15:48:53 +0100
  • 9c9f4f0bb5 update ADOdb to 5.20.8 to fix PostgreSQL not working with PHP 8.1 (affected_rows() returns false) ralf 2023-01-30 12:09:51 +0100
  • 7416b158b2 update ADOdb to 5.20.8 to fix PostgreSQL not working with PHP 8.1 (affected_rows() returns false) ralf 2023-01-30 12:09:15 +0100
  • f2eae9041a * Mail/OAuth: fix not working auth with custom Office365 domains outside mail wizard Mailserver was not available, so OAuth was not detected, when trying to get a new access-token for a refresh-token ralf 2023-01-30 10:19:41 +0100
  • c3ec0e88cb
    Update videoconference.svg StefanU 2023-01-29 17:45:46 +0100
  • b98289f78c
    Update favorites.svg StefanU 2023-01-29 16:45:41 +0100
  • 4684eee507
    Update fav_filter.svg StefanU 2023-01-29 16:44:18 +0100
  • 55eeb3c8fd
    Update login_logo.svg StefanU 2023-01-29 16:25:31 +0100
  • 7fc7f67e35
    Update mime128_directory.svg StefanU 2023-01-29 10:57:15 +0100
  • d94c10b09f Mail: Prefer client-side lavatar over server-side in mail list nathan 2023-01-27 15:10:25 -0700
  • f503743956 Use client-side Et2LAvatar instead of image for Et2SelectEmail options & tags Should now be only avatar.php image when provided nathan 2023-01-27 13:26:50 -0700
  • a5739072e9 updating developer install after experiences with Hadi's Ubuntu 22.04 update ralf 2023-01-27 20:57:49 +0100
  • 5bab72b8be Use client-side Et2LAvatar for user accounts whenever possible, only using avatar.php when there's a real image. nathan 2023-01-27 10:34:40 -0700
  • 0fc4c88aca
    Update logo.svg StefanU 2023-01-27 15:07:18 +0100
  • 9cebab3c2f Fix readonly selects could display 'undefined' with no value and no emptyLabel nathan 2023-01-26 12:58:37 -0700
  • bf6cca24fd Et2Favorites: Make star icon bigger nathan 2023-01-26 09:22:45 -0700
  • df315e8f96 Make sure placeholder list can scroll nathan 2023-01-26 08:52:54 -0700
  • 55054024b6 fix PHP Deprecated errors visible in egroupware-docker-install.log ralf 2023-01-26 10:42:18 +0100
  • 0fe421658e Make phone icon color nathan 2023-01-25 15:16:08 -0700
  • e4e0610a41 Et2LinkAppSelect: Use configured app link icon instead of always using navbar nathan 2023-01-25 15:14:14 -0700
  • 62bc77a4d2 Make sure egw.lang() doesn't error trying to translate option label nathan 2023-01-25 14:22:36 -0700
  • df2b52a03b
    Create goup.svg StefanU 2023-01-25 22:22:25 +0100
  • fc693cdac2
    Update goup.svg StefanU 2023-01-25 22:21:25 +0100
  • f637da2775
    Update cake.svg StefanU 2023-01-25 22:18:30 +0100
  • 1a098eefa9
    Update MailFolderTemplates.svg StefanU 2023-01-25 22:16:15 +0100
  • 616e35a58d
    Update MailFolderSent.svg StefanU 2023-01-25 22:15:01 +0100
  • 1eb135dea4
    Update kfm_home.svg StefanU 2023-01-25 22:14:00 +0100
  • ab7ee4621b
    Update MailFolderHam.svg StefanU 2023-01-25 22:03:02 +0100
  • 345feb76e7
    Update MailFolderJunk.svg StefanU 2023-01-25 22:02:08 +0100
  • 8de8cbc082
    Update arrow_down.svg StefanU 2023-01-25 21:59:01 +0100
  • 8c6ced73b7
    Update home.svg StefanU 2023-01-25 21:57:33 +0100
  • 7fd22b33a3
    Update new.svg StefanU 2023-01-25 21:54:26 +0100
  • 4b8b454566 Make sure values are strings, otherwise they might not match comparison nathan 2023-01-25 13:43:35 -0700
  • 71f4a93d56 Calendar: Fix drag and drop to move event in Firefox nathan 2023-01-25 11:25:00 -0700
  • e7259612f1 fix error exporting LDAP accounts to SQL: array_key_exits parameter #2 must be of type array, bool given ralf 2023-01-25 19:12:51 +0100
  • ad05cd493e fix error exporting LDAP accounts to SQL: array_key_exits parameter #2 must be of type array, bool given ralf 2023-01-25 19:12:51 +0100
  • a924bf7dbc add missing closing tag ralf 2023-01-25 18:49:00 +0100
  • bc17e9dc68 Add click to compose handler for addresses displayed in mail preview Hadi Nategh 2023-01-25 16:23:11 +0100
  • 07d6488593 defer calls to mail_refreshFolderStatus for 2s, to accumulate updates of multiple rows e.g. deleting multiple emails ralf 2023-01-25 14:55:06 +0100
  • 77d6a7e648 Fix some styling issues and set message's date to display date and time Hadi Nategh 2023-01-25 14:59:01 +0100
  • e56055f12d defer calls to mail_refreshFolderStatus for 2s, to accumulate updates of multiple rows e.g. deleting multiple emails ralf 2023-01-25 14:55:06 +0100
  • b286e081f5 Updating dependencies for 23.1.20230125 23.1.20230125 ralf 2023-01-25 14:25:39 +0100
  • 38e9d9984f Changelog for 23.1.20230125 ralf 2023-01-25 14:21:51 +0100
  • b0f5cfbcdb improve OAuth mail authentication by not opening wizard multiple time also avoid authentication loop, if there is an error ralf 2023-01-25 13:38:40 +0100
  • 09ceed3ba2 rename/move Api\avatar::lavatar() to Api\Contacts\Lavatar::generate() to be in line with our CS ralf 2023-01-25 12:27:26 +0100
  • 6ef78c9591 Revert "Fix missing translation on read-only select" ralf 2023-01-25 09:46:22 +0100
  • 72252f0fba New folder icon from Stefan for directory mime nathan 2023-01-24 16:29:20 -0700
  • 0d8157b508 Calendar: Make all integration switch icons the same gray when disabled nathan 2023-01-24 16:18:29 -0700
  • c7020c79d8 Calendar: Allow calendar integration to specify a caption, not just use app name nathan 2023-01-24 16:11:49 -0700
  • 4e5f68f97c Fix missing translation on read-only select nathan 2023-01-24 14:42:55 -0700